Portfolio Audit & Investment Governance
Managing wealth demands more than performance; it demands accountability. We deliver fully independent audits of portfolio performance, risk exposure, and governance practices for institutional investors, family offices, and HNWIs. Free from any affiliation with banks, asset managers, or product providers, we examine what others overlook: attribution of returns, fee structures, leverage, valuation methods, and the integrity of reporting. The result is an unbiased picture of how your assets are truly being managed.

We evaluate whether portfolio returns can be explained by market exposure, investment strategy, or manager skill. Our analysis identifies abnormal performance and provides an independent assessment of value creation relative to benchmarks and risk levels. This analysis is also central to detecting mismanagement, excessive risk-taking, or undisclosed strategies.

We review the accuracy, completeness, and transparency of portfolio reporting provided by banks and asset managers. Where multiple custodians, managers, or entities are involved, we consolidate reporting into a coherent framework that facilitates oversight and decision-making.

We assess the robustness and suitability of asset allocation methodologies used in portfolio construction. Our review examines diversification, risk-adjusted performance, factor exposure, investment objectives, and adherence to governance frameworks.

We analyse corporate or institutional treasury functions, including liquidity management, cash allocation, hedging strategies, and investment policies. Our reviews help identify inefficiencies, governance weaknesses, and opportunities for yield optimization and improved risk management.
